Output 3d66380037a31e73610648954bafc8e3daabc8b85aa9c455a18fd511b1a50fc6:1

value
2483770128
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4310e39cf53ec7a50948a379cb10ac1321e5ae88 OP_EQUALVERIFY OP_CHECKSIG
address
177cWL5CHaaQzBmbg9kABptL5Tg7LMJFgX
transaction
3d66380037a31e73610648954bafc8e3daabc8b85aa9c455a18fd511b1a50fc6
spent
true